Unleash your full potential in Physics for JEE (Main & Advanced), BITSAT, and NEET with the Physics Galaxy Lecture Notes by Ashish Arora (Set of 4 volumes). This meticulously curated collection is directly derived from Arora Sir's acclaimed Physics Galaxy video lectures, ensuring a proven and effective teaching methodology.
The set covers the complete Physics syllabus across four essential segments: Mechanics; Thermodynamics, Oscillation & Waves; Electricity & Magnetism; and Optics & Modern Physics.
Each volume presents complex concepts in a clear, structured, and easy-to-understand manner. The books are enriched with key formulas, solved examples, shortcut techniques, and concept boosters, making this a perfect resource for both initial learning and quick revision.
